A resolution designating the month of August 2007 as "National Medicine Abuse Awareness Month".

6/26/2007--Passed Senate without amendment.    (There is 1 other summary)

(This measure has not been amended since it was introduced. The summary of that version is repeated here.)

Designates August 2007 as National Medicine Abuse Awareness Month.

Urges communities to carry out appropriate programs and activities to educate parents and youth of the potential dangers associated with medicine abuse.
